KT Wiz manager Lee Kang-chul wished for a speedy recovery for Jang Du-seong (Lotte outfielder), who suffered a lung contusion during the match against the Lotte Giants on the 12th.

Jang Du-seong started as the No. 1 center fielder in the 9th match of the season against KT at Suwon KT Wiz Park on the 12th, and he was transported by ambulance after sustaining an injury in the top of the 10th inning.

In the top of the 10th inning, tied 7-7 with one out, Jang Du-seong drew a walk against KT's reliever Park Young-hyun. Afterward, while Go Seung-min was at bat, he was hit hard in the left side of his body by a pick-off attempt from Park Young-hyun at first base.

Despite the pain, Jang Du-seong saw the ball slip away and sprinted to second base, but after arriving, he lay on the ground, vomiting blood and expressing significant discomfort. Coach Yoo Jae-shin gestured that Jang Du-seong was experiencing an issue and requested emergency assistance. Fortunately, Jang Du-seong managed to lift himself up but was transported to the hospital via ambulance.

Ahead of the match against the Daegu Samsung Lions on the 13th, manager Lee Kang-chul expressed regret over Jang Du-seong's unexpected injury, saying, "It was an incident that happened during the game, and it was not intentional, but nonetheless, I feel genuinely sorry that Jang Du-seong got injured. I hope it’s not a serious injury. The head coach also contacted to convey his apologies."

According to KT officials, Kim Tae-hyoung, KT's head coach, called Lotte's head coach Jo Won-woo after the game on the 12th, saying, "It was an incident that happened during the game, but I’m sorry that the player got injured. I hope it’s not a serious injury. Please convey my message to manager Kim Tae-hyoung as well." Park Young-hyun also directly called Jang Du-seong to express his apologies.

Meanwhile, a Lotte official stated regarding Jang Du-seong's current condition, "Jang Du-seong is hospitalized at a certain hospital in Suwon and has received a recommendation that it would be fine for him to be discharged as there is no longer any visible bleeding. He is likely to move to his home in Cheonan to rest," adding that "he will undergo further examination at Samsung Seoul Hospital on the 16th."
